选用理由:

  1. 强调集群无单点,可拓展,任意一点高可用,水平可拓展。
  2. 海量消息堆积能力,消息堆积后,写入低延迟。
  3. 支持上万个队列。
  4. 消息失败重试机制
  5. 消息可查询
  6. 开源社区活跃
  7. 成熟度(经过双十一考验)
    RocketMQ 自动实现负载均衡
    阿里分布式核心技术:OceanBase(海量分布式存储)、 RocketMQ
    nameServer比zookeeper更轻量级、性能更好更稳定。

RocketMQ学习相关推荐

  1. RocketMQ学习笔记(7)----RocketMQ的整体架构

    1. RocketMQ主要的9个模块,如图: 2. 模块介绍 1. rocketmq-common:通用的常量枚举,基类方法或者数据结构,按描述的目标来分包,通俗易懂.报名有admin,consume ...

  2. 2020年,RocketMQ面试题 -面试题驱动RocketMQ学习

    本文是<从 0 开始带你成为消息中间件实战高手>内容总结,版权问题,特此声明 本篇文章持续更新,大概有上百道题,用这些题来驱动RocketMQ学习,在面试中也会脱颖而出!! 15 解决订单 ...

  3. JavaEE 企业级分布式高级架构师(二十)RocketMQ学习笔记(2)

    RocketMQ学习笔记 进阶篇 消息样例 普通消息 消息发送 发送同步消息 发送异步消息 单向发送消息 三种发送方式的对比 消费消息 顺序消息 如何保证顺序 顺序的实现 MessageListene ...

  4. RocketMQ学习笔记(8)----RocketMQ的Producer API简介

    在RocketMQ中提供了三种发送消息的模式: 1.NormalProducer(普通) 2.OrderProducer(顺序) 3.TransactionProducer(事务) 下面来介绍一下pr ...

  5. RocketMQ学习笔记

    RocketMQ学习笔记 文章目录 RocketMQ学习笔记 前言 为什么要使用消息队列? 解耦 异步 削峰 使用了消息队列会有什么缺点? 消息队列如何选型? 如何保证消息队列是高可用的? 如何保证消 ...

  6. rocketmq 组监听_最全的RocketMQ学习指南,程序员必备的中间件技能

    一.简介 RocketMq是阿里开发出来的一个消息中间件,后捐献给Apache.官网上是这样介绍的: Apache RocketMQ™ is a unified messaging engine, l ...

  7. RocketMQ学习(一):简介和QuickStart

    RocketMQ是什么? 引用官方描述: RocketMQ是一款分布式.队列模型的消息中间件,具有以下特点: 支持严格的消息顺序 支持Topic与Queue两种模式 亿级消息堆积能力 比较友好的分布式 ...

  8. RocketMQ学习第一步之源码构建

    这里写目录标题 绪论 源码构建 1.clone 2. 构建 3.配置 3.1配置namesrv 3.2新建文件夹 3.3 配置broker 3.4 配置producer 3.5 配置 consumer ...

  9. RocketMQ学习笔记:基础知识和安装启动

    这是本人学习的总结,主要学习资料如下 马士兵教育 rocketMq官方文档 目录 1.架构 2.基本概念 3.安装和启动 3.1.命令行启动 3.1.1.启动Server 3.1.2.启动Broker ...

  10. RocketMQ学习笔记(持续更新)

    文章目录 前言 一.RocketMQ是什么? 1. 基本概念 2. 功能特性 3. 为什么选择RocketMQ? 二.架构设计 1.技术架构 2.部署架构 部署特点 三.安装启动 常用命令 四.简单实 ...

最新文章

  1. 专属于教育界的定律,你知道哪一些?
  2. mysql连接查询作业答案_MySQL连表查询练习题
  3. HDU - 5876 Sparse Graph(bfs+set)
  4. Enterprise search - Build Search dropdown list - cache issue
  5. Linux启动shell的快捷方式,Linux下为可执行shell脚本文件(.sh),制作桌面启动快捷方式...
  6. python 函数嵌套 报错_《Python》 函数嵌套、闭包和迭代器
  7. 从 Web1.0 到 3.0 你不知道的互联网的演进史!
  8. 拓端tecdat|R语言使用Bass模型进行手机市场产品周期预测
  9. 上粱正,下粱不歪——网吧母盘制作流程(转)
  10. 手势密码解锁微信小程序项目源码
  11. 关于Steam服务器登录的一些问题的解决方案
  12. Django数据映射 一对一 一对多 多对多
  13. 智能音箱音效哪个好_智能音箱这么多,哪个智能音箱,才是现在最好的
  14. 苹果cms重名视频怎么合并
  15. 【解决方案】adb无法连接雷电模拟器问题
  16. 小程序开发:WeUI用npm导入
  17. UVA:10118 Free Candies
  18. Amber中的NMR restraint中的一些参数的设置的意义
  19. 光刻机:半导体工业最耀眼的明珠
  20. 现在的微博营销方案具备哪些特点呢?

热门文章

  1. software engineering homework, product analysis
  2. python读取命令行输入-python获取命令行输入参数列表
  3. 83998 连接服务器出错_来申请一个阿里云服务器玩玩?
  4. python文件writelines_python 写文件write(string), writelines(list)
  5. ajax动态获取url参数值,获取URL参数的方法
  6. 数组字典_VBA数组与字典解决方案第34讲:数组的传递
  7. sql md5函数_【学习笔记】常见漏洞:SQL注入的利用与防御
  8. python办公自动化excel_python办公自动化:Excel操作入门
  9. linux tomcat环境变量配置_Tomcat
  10. clickhouse建库_专访ClickHouse创始人:数据库竞争依旧火热,技术整合势在必行